89 Turnberry is a 171 m² / 1,841 sq ft detached home in Ouston. It sold for £520,000 in March 2026. Indexed forward to today's value, that sale is roughly £520k. Recent local prices imply a broad valuation context of £215k to £402k based on its internal area. The Land Registry and EPC data was last updated 1 June 2026.
